美文网首页
简单的Makefile编译ArNetworking的例子

简单的Makefile编译ArNetworking的例子

作者: xuxiang | 来源:发表于2023-06-22 11:02 被阅读0次

OBJS = main.o

TARGET = main

CC = g++

CFLAGS = -fPIC -g -Wall

ARIA_INCLUDE = -I/usr/local/Aria/include -I/usr/local/Aria/ArNetworking/include

ARIA_LINK = -L/usr/local/Aria/lib -lAria -lArNetworking -lpthread -ldl -lrt

$(TARGET):$(OBJS)

    $(CC) $(CFLAGS) $(ARIA_INCLUDE) $< -o $@ @(ARIA_LINK)

%.o:%.cpp

    $(CC) $(CFLAGS) $(ARIA_INCLUDE) -c $<

clean:

    rm -rf $(TARGET) $(OBJS)

    @echo "Clean up ompleted!";

相关文章

  • Makefile 学习

    Makefile 一、Makefile 简单使用 Makefile是Linux系统下的一种编译脚本,更快、更方便的...

  • Makefile基础

    介绍 Wikipedia上的 Makefile介绍。简单来说:  Makefile就是告诉gcc/g++如何编译项...

  • MakeFile详解

    什么是 Makefile 呢? Makefile 可以简单的认为是一个工程文件的编译规则,描述了整个工程的编译和链...

  • Makefile笔记

    Makefile 笔记 一、简单的 Makefile 例子 文档目录结构文档目录结构是用户目录HOME下有src ...

  • makefile写法

    makefile写法 规则 三要素: 目标 依赖 命令 语法:目标:依赖条件命令 例子: 改进: 只是编译修改的部...

  • [C] Makefile

    Makefile Blog [Makefile的简便写法] [Makefile]菜鸟教程 [gcc编译声明问题] ...

  • android cmake 简介

    一、简单介绍 a、在 linux 平台下使用 CMake 生成 Makefile 并编译的流程如下: 二、简单使用...

  • 一个makefile的简单例子

    变量定义: 变量使用: 目标文件:依赖项执行命令 使用方式: $@ 代表目标 $+ 代表依赖项

  • Makefile 例子

    C_SOURCES = (wildcard kernel/.h drivers/.h) Nice syntax f...

  • Raspberry kernel module compile

    Source code Makefile Local 直接在树莓派上编译 Makefile Crosscompil...

网友评论

      本文标题:简单的Makefile编译ArNetworking的例子

      本文链接:https://www.haomeiwen.com/subject/viopydtx.html